The Rise of Smart Electric Bikes
The concept of a "smart" electric bike refers to an e-bike that integrates digital technologies, such as IoT (Internet of Things), AI (Artificial Intelligence), and advanced sensor systems. These innovations allow for real-time data collection, connectivity with other devices, and improved user control. With the rise of these smart features, e-bikes are becoming more than just a means of transportation—they are evolving into sophisticated systems that offer a personalized and efficient riding experience.
Advanced Features in Smart Electric Bikes
One of the most significant advancements in smart e-bikes is the integration of IoT. This technology allows bikes to connect to smartphones and other devices, enabling riders to monitor their speed, battery life, and route in real-time. The connectivity also facilitates over-the-air updates, ensuring that the e-bike's software remains up-to-date with the latest features and improvements.
AI is another game-changing technology in the e-bike industry. AI-powered systems can learn from a rider's habits, adjusting the motor's assistance level based on the terrain or the rider's pedaling style. This not only enhances the riding experience but also optimizes battery usage, making the ride more efficient.
Additionally, smart electric bikes often come equipped with advanced sensor systems that monitor various aspects of the ride. For example, some e-bikes feature sensors that detect obstacles, alerting the rider to potential dangers. Others include gyroscopic sensors that stabilize the bike, providing a safer ride, especially on uneven terrain.

The Future of Urban Mobility: E-Bikes in Smart Cities
As cities around the world embrace the concept of smart cities, smart electric bikes are poised to play a crucial role in the future of urban mobility. The integration of e-bikes into city infrastructure is becoming increasingly common, with dedicated bike lanes, charging stations, and bike-sharing programs making it easier than ever to adopt e-bikes as a primary mode of transportation.
In a smart city, e-bikes can connect with public transportation systems, allowing riders to plan seamless multimodal journeys. For instance, a rider could use an e-bike for the first mile of their commute, and then switch to a train or bus for the remainder of the trip. This level of connectivity not only reduces traffic congestion but also contributes to a cleaner, more sustainable urban environment.
